Job Duties

To provide professional oversight for authorized construction and design projects on behalf of the Department of Corrections for all phases of the work from inception to completion while assuring the Departments needs are being met.

Minimum Qualifications

Some experience managing long term construction projects. Knowledge and experience with the Department of General Services’ DEB policies and procedures. Experience negotiating and managing highly complex construction projects. Ability to be accurate, self-regulating, and able to work independently and creatively, Ability to communicate in a highly refined and compelling manner, both written and verbal.

Additional Considerations

Architectural or Engineering Degree or equivalent related experience and any Professional Certifications or Licenses related to Construction. Comprehensive knowledge of the Department of Corrections’ operation. Knowledge of the Department of Purchasing and Supply policies and procedures. Comprehensive knowledge of procurement and contracting, contract administration, and state procurement and procurement audit requirements. Comprehensive knowledge of the Capital Outlay process and a full understanding of the Construction and Professional Services Manual (CPSM).
